Strait

/stɹeɪt/

noun

  1. A narrow channel of water connecting two larger bodies of water.

    The Strait of Gibraltar

  2. A narrow pass, passage or street.

  3. A neck of land; an isthmus.

verb

  1. To confine; put to difficulties.

  2. To tighten.

adjective

  1. Narrow; restricted as to space or room; close.

  2. Righteous, strict.

    to follow the strait and narrow

  3. Tight; close; tight-fitting.

adverb

  1. Strictly; rigorously.
